<strong>Unified</strong> <strong>Government</strong> <strong>of</strong> <strong>Wyandotte</strong> <strong>County</strong>/Kansas City, KansasDepartment Overview:2012 Amended and 2013 Operating BudgetDepartment OverviewFire DepartmentThe Kansas City, Kansas Fire Department is charged with the responsibility <strong>of</strong> protecting the residentialand business citizens <strong>of</strong> Kansas City, Kansas from the catastrophic effects <strong>of</strong> fire, hazardous materialincidents, medical emergencies, and other direct or indirect threats to life and property.Important Issues: Continue to work toward increased compliance with National Standards (Best Practices) Update and modernize existing facilities to meet ADA standards Update facilities to meet gender neutral standards Comprehensive plan must be developed to address the need to replace/modernize agingfacilities Re-establish ten-year replacement program for all fire apparatus (currently 60% <strong>of</strong> the frontlineapparatus need to be replaced under the 10-year program) Maintain established three-year replacement program for EMS units Acquire a permanent and functional maintenance/property/storage facility Maintain adequate staffing levels.Highlights: Highest number <strong>of</strong> calls for service recorded by KCKFD (25,744) One <strong>of</strong> the best average response times, if not the best average, in the metro area (3 minutes41 seconds) 15,670 patients transported by KCKFD EMS units Responded to 2,297 fire calls Over 1300 smoke detectors distributed free <strong>of</strong> charge to KCK residents Over 5,000 children and adults instructed in Fire Safety Education Developed satellite Emergency Operations Center at Fire Headquarters Received improved ISO (Insurance Service Organization) rating through a comprehensive anddetailed evaluation <strong>of</strong> fire service response capabilities. Overall rating improvement could meansubstantial savings through the lowering <strong>of</strong> insurance premiums for both businesses andhomeowners alikeNew Initiatives: Conduct strategic study <strong>of</strong> fire station facilities to analyze optimum location and companyplacement in the city. Revamp firefighter wellness program to meet national standards Update and replace computer hardware and peripherals Seek grant funding from all sources to improve efficiency and safety <strong>of</strong> firefighters and residents Seek existing grant funds to acquire an emergency response vehicle that has air generatingcapabilities, emergency scene lighting capabilities, and firefighter rehab functions61
